The pre holiday decoration party was a success. We came up with quite an eclectic Saloon :) Moby contributed snowflakes on the glass behind the bar and the windows and a string of Dilbert and Dogbert lites. Patti was in charge of stringing popcorn and cranberries and decorating Mike :)

Maxbaron put up some garland and Dennis added a pine garland on the fireplace mantel. Lather added a ristra which we learned is a wreath of dried hot peppers. Mitzi added parrot and chili pepper lites. Carrie, Angelica and Andrea also helped with tinsel and such. We had great eggnog and lots of nice food and good music.
